#9523bb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9523bb is composed of 58.4% red, 13.7%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.3% cyan, 81.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 285 degrees, a saturation of 68.5% and a lightness of 43.5%. #9523bb color hex could be obtained by blending #ff46ff with #2b0077.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

Shades and Tints of #9523bb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040105 is the darkest color, while #fbf4fd is the lightest one.
